When planning a hardscape project, several factors influence your final investment. The total square footage is the primary driver, but the complexity of the design—such as curves, patterns, or multi-level tiers—adds to labor time. Site accessibility matters too; if crews need specialized equipment to move materials into a tight backyard, that affects the bottom line. Material choice, from standard concrete blocks to premium natural stone, significantly shifts the budget. Additionally, your current ground condition determines how much excavation and base preparation is required for long-term stability.

Hardscaping refers to the inanimate elements of your landscape design, such as patios, walkways, driveways, and retaining walls. It's about creating functional and visually appealing structures that enhance outdoor living. For Phoenix residents, it often means creating cool, shaded areas and durable surfaces that can withstand intense sun.
A paver patio where you might place your patio chairs is a common example of hardscaping. Other examples include stone walkways, decorative fire pits, or a durable outdoor kitchen area. These elements provide structure and define outdoor spaces, making them more enjoyable and practical for Phoenix homeowners.
